# Firmware update channel for Pinewrench devices.
# This module controls how units on the "stable" channel poll the
# Ordbury update service: poll cadence, staged-rollout percentages,
# and rollback trigger thresholds. Reviewers: changes here affect the
# entire fleet, so any modification needs sign-off from the firmware
# lead and a canary run on the lab rack. Rationale for each value is
# in the design doc. The constants are defined below.

constants for fajop-tahaf:
RATE_LIMITS = {
    "holael": 2,
    "oliael": 10,
    "druael": 10,
    "wenwyn": 10,
}

## Artifact Signing — GiftNote Mailer

All release artifacts for the GiftNote donation-receipt mailer must be signed before promotion to the Larkspur registry. The CI stage `sign-bundle` runs after unit tests pass and rejects unsigned tarballs at the gate. Reviewers should confirm the signature step references the current release identity. The key used for signing releases is shown below.

signing key of bagap-yawep = bky13_TbfT6ZMUoGJo2

Subject: Kiosk watchdog cut-over complete

Team,

The watchdog for the Brightlane kiosk app was cut over to the new supervisor tonight at 02:10. Old heartbeat checks are disabled; the new process restarts the UI shell after three missed pings. Rollback is a single flag flip if kiosks start cycling. Watch the Pinefield lobby units first — they had the flakiest network. The active configuration the watchdog is now running with is as follows.

settings of kajef-hafog:
[ralys]
team = holiel
access_code = ac_fa834c
owner = noviel.gilion
host = ralys.halixlabs.test
port = 9300
peer = raldor.ordindata.local
salt = e78ca807
pin = 4961